Concentration Cells02:41

Concentration Cells

25.9K
A concentration cell is a type of a  voltaic cell constructed by connecting two almost identical half-cells, both based on the same half-reaction and using the same electrode, differing only in the concentration of one redox species. A concentration cell's potential, therefore, is determined only by the concentration difference of the particular redox species.

Cell Size01:22

Cell Size

128.2K
Cell sizes vary widely among and within organisms. Bacterial cells range between 1-10 micrometers (μm)and are considerably smaller than most eukaryotic cells. The smallest bacteria are 0.1 μm in diameter—about a thousand times smaller than eukaryotic cells, which typically range from 10-100 μm.

Desafíos para la comercialización de las células solares de perovskita

Yaoguang Rong1, Yue Hu1, Anyi Mei1,2

  • 1Michael Grätzel Center for Mesoscopic Solar Cells, Wuhan National Laboratory for Optoelectronics, Huazhong University of Science and Technology, Wuhan 430074, Hubei, China.

Science (New York, N.Y.)
|September 22, 2018
PubMed
Resumen

Las células solares de perovskita (PSC) son muy prometedoras, pero se enfrentan a desafíos de estabilidad y aumento de escala. La investigación se centra en pruebas estandarizadas y análisis de degradación para acelerar la comercialización.

Área de la Ciencia:

  • Ciencias de los materiales
  • Energía renovable
  • Las instalaciones fotovoltaicas

Sus antecedentes:

  • Las células solares de perovskita (PSC) han logrado altas eficiencias de conversión de energía.
  • La comercialización se ve obstaculizada por una estabilidad limitada y un aumento de escala no comprobado.

Objetivo del estudio:

  • Para resumir los avances en las empresas de servicios públicos hacia la viabilidad comercial.
  • Identificar los desafíos pendientes y proponer soluciones para la comercialización de las PSC.

Principales métodos:

  • Revisión de los avances recientes en materia de estabilidad y ampliación de la CPS.
  • Discutir protocolos estandarizados para distinguir los factores de degradación.
  • Análisis de pruebas de envejecimiento acelerado y cinética de degradación para la predicción de la vida útil.

Principales resultados:

  • Se han logrado avances significativos en la eficiencia y la estabilidad de la CPS.
  • Se están desarrollando protocolos normalizados para comprender la degradación.
  • Las pruebas de envejecimiento acelerado ayudan a predecir la vida útil de los dispositivos.

Conclusiones:

  • Abordar la estabilidad y el aumento de escala es fundamental para la comercialización de PSC.
  • Las perspectivas de las tecnologías fotovoltaicas maduras pueden orientar el desarrollo de la PSC.
  • Es esencial proseguir la investigación sobre los mecanismos de degradación y las pruebas estandarizadas.
